United Nations Trust Territory

A United Nations Trust Territory is a region that was placed under the administration of the UN to help guide it towards self-governance and independence. This arrangement often occurred after World War II, where territories previously governed by colonial powers were transitioned to self-rule. The UN oversaw these areas to ensure they developed politically and economically, promoting stability and democratic governance. Trust Territories could eventually become independent states or join existing countries, depending on the wishes of their inhabitants and the outcomes of the UN's oversight.
